📌 What Is Wi-Fi 6?

Wi-Fi 6, officially known as IEEE 802.11ax, was released in 2019.
Its mission is simple:

Faster speeds, higher efficiency, and better performance when many devices are connected at the same time.

Unlike previous Wi-Fi upgrades that focused mostly on “top speed,” Wi-Fi 6 is more about efficiency and stability — especially when your network gets crowded.


🚀 Core Benefits of Wi-Fi 6 (What Makes It So Good?)

1. Much Faster Speeds – Up to 9.6 Gbps

Wi-Fi 6 boosts the theoretical maximum speed from Wi-Fi 5’s 3.5 Gbps to 9.6 Gbps.
This doesn’t mean a single device will hit that number, but it means:

👉 There’s more bandwidth to share, so every device benefits.


2. Supports More Devices at Once (Huge Upgrade)

This is the heart of Wi-Fi 6.

🔹 OFDMA technology: Multiple people can "ride in separate carriages" simultaneously

   In the past, Wi-Fi was like "a car carrying one passenger at a time."
   Now, Wi-Fi 6 can break down a car into multiple "carriages," carrying many more people at once.

→ Result: Less congestion, lower latency, smoother experience.


3. MU-MIMO Upgraded from 4 Streams → 8 Streams

Wi-Fi 6 expands MU-MIMO to support up to 8 simultaneous streams, and it works in both uplink and downlink.

This is perfect for:

  • Offices

  • Schools

  • Large households

  • High-density public environments


4. Stronger Performance With 1024-QAM

Wi-Fi 6 upgrades modulation from 256-QAM → 1024-QAM.

Meaning:

  • More data transmitted per signal

  • Higher throughput

  • Better performance even at medium range


5. Better Battery Life With TWT (Target Wake Time)

Wi-Fi 6 lets devices “schedule” when to wake up and communicate.

Ideal for:

  • Smart locks

  • Sensors

  • Battery-powered cameras

  • Any IoT devices

Less waking = longer battery life.


6. Lower Latency & More Stable Connections

With OFDMA + MU-MIMO + BSS Coloring working together, Wi-Fi 6 delivers:

  • More stable gaming

  • Smoother video calls

  • Faster response time when many devices connect

This is where Wi-Fi 6 feels really different from Wi-Fi 5.


🔍 Wi-Fi 6 vs Wi-Fi 5 — The Quick Comparison

Feature Wi-Fi 5 (802.11ac) Wi-Fi 6 (802.11ax)
Max Speed ~3.5 Gbps Up to 9.6 Gbps
Frequency Bands 5 GHz 2.4 GHz + 5 GHz
OFDMA ✔ Yes
MU-MIMO Downlink only Uplink + Downlink
Modulation 256-QAM 1024-QAM
Interference Handling Average Much stronger
Power Efficiency Normal Higher efficiency

In short:

Wi-Fi 5 is fast. Wi-Fi 6 is fast and smart.

How Wi-Fi 6 Works (Simple Explanations of Complex Tech)

🟦 OFDMA

Multiple devices share the same channel at the same time.

🟩 MU-MIMO

Multiple antennas talk to multiple devices simultaneously.

🟨 BSS Coloring

“Color codes” overlapping networks to reduce interference.

🟥 1024-QAM

Squeezes more data into each transmission.

🟪 TWT (Target Wake Time)

Schedules device wakeups to save power.

These technologies together are why Wi-Fi 6 feels so much more modern.

📱 Devices That Support Wi-Fi 6

Most modern devices already support Wi-Fi 6, including:

  • iPhone 11 and newer

  • Samsung Galaxy S10 and newer

  • 2020+ MacBooks & iPads

  • PlayStation 5 / Xbox Series X

  • Nearly all laptops released after 2020

  • Any router labeled “AX” (AX1800, AX3000, AX5400, etc.)
